Statement of Purpose:

Under the supervision of the Coding Supervisor and the direction of the Director of Health Information Management the Coding Analyst codes hospital records for the purpose of reimbursement, research and compliance with federal regulations according to job diagnosis (es), operation(s), and procedure(s) using ICD-10-CM & CPT classification systems. The Coding Analyst ensures accuracy and timely statistics while supporting the financial stability of the organization while ensuring compliance with requirements related to the Prospective Payment System.

Qualifications:

Education: Minimum qualifications required include completion of an accredited coding program or accredited Medical Records program.

Certification / License: CCA (Certified Coding Assistant), CCS (Certified Coding Specialist) or RHIT (Registered Health Information Technician) preferred.

Experience: 1 year experience preferred, but will train with above minimum qualifications.

MRMC Differentials:

Hospital differentials are: $3.50 hourly for evenings, $4.75 hourly for nights, and $2.75 hourly for weekends. All differentials are paid based per hospital policy.
